AB  - Our study showed that the Ni concentration of 2,0 mg Ni kg-1 soil significantly reduced the total number of microorganisms and the numbers of ammonifiers, actinomycetes and fungi. The number of Azotobacter was increased in the presence of Ni. The Ni concentration of 2,0 mg Ni kg-1 soil was decreased dehydrogenase activity in soil under the wheat, the sugerbeet and soyabean. DHA was increased in the presence of Ni in soil under the corn and the sunflower.
